Output 6818d54c81d62ac804a69590f1e346f24cac3e076eb246ecd1d0490fa630240b:0

value
3372046
script pubkey
OP_0 OP_PUSHBYTES_20 1d072bb83184ed8f46b0b57a3ce8c49238e16e7f
address
bc1qr5rjhwp3snkc734sk4are6xyjguwzmnlyqzdeh
transaction
6818d54c81d62ac804a69590f1e346f24cac3e076eb246ecd1d0490fa630240b
confirmations
99607
spent
true